Arsenal and Manchester United keep a close eye on Gotze situation

Premier League giants Arsenal and Manchester United have reportedly been alerted to a release clause in Mario Gotze’s contract with Borussia Dortmund says the Daily Mail. The prodigal playmaker, who is a youth product of Borussia has been on the shortlist of several other top clubs around Europe including Spanish giants Real Madrid.

Arsenal manager Arsene Wenger is well known to be a long term admirer of the young German international and reports suggest that he is willing to exercise the option of the reported £30 million release clause in January. Wenger could have money at his disposal in January owing to a new deal with sponsors Emirates a few days ago and Gotze could be the ideal addition to a squad that is in desperate need of some quality players.

Meanwhile, Premier League leaders Manchester United too are keeping tabs on the player and might want to challenge their rivals Arsenal to sign the 20 year old star. Gotze though is contracted with the German Champions Dortmund until 2016 and could be a difficult man to prise away. He is also in good form this season for Dortmund netting 7 times in 19 appearances in all competitions thus far.

Interestingly, both teams could well see the extra investment worth it for a player who is already blooded at the top level and could ditch their plans to sign another 20-year old prodigy Wilfried Zaha. Tthe young Englishman, while also an exceptional talent is also believed to be rather expensively priced, and is yet to play even a single game in the Premier League, making Gotze value for money option at this stage.
